India’s export of engineering goods crosses $8 bn mark in May 2021

May 2021 witnessed YoY growth for engineering goods and the US topped as India's export destination at $1,022 million. Shipments to China continued to decline and fell sharply by 35% to $444.65 million, says EEPC India.Read more
